Chikungunya Virus: Wisconsin Data
There have been 24 reported cases of travel-associated chikungunya virus in Wisconsin from 2015 to 2024. All of these illnesses were reported from people who traveled to a country outside of the U.S. where chikungunya is spread. Chikungunya is preventable.
